The Lunora code generator. It parses your `lunora/schema.ts` plus every function file under `lunora/`, then writes `lunora/_generated/` so the rest of your app gets typed access to its own backend. The core outputs are `api.ts` (the `api` / `internal` function references), `server.ts` (the `query` / `mutation` / `action` / `internalQuery` / `internalMutation` / `internalAction` / `definePolicy` procedure builders bound to your schema), and `dataModel.ts` (the `Doc` / `Id` types). It also emits `app.ts`, `functions.ts`, `shard.ts`, Drizzle schemas, and — when the relevant features are used — `crons.ts`, `containers.ts`, `workflows.ts`, `vectors.ts`, `seed.ts`, and OpenAPI/OpenRPC specs.
Most apps never call this package directly — the `lunora codegen` CLI command and the `@lunora/vite` plugin invoke it for you.
Part of the [Lunora](https://github.com/anolilab/lunora) framework — a type-safe, real-time backend on Cloudflare Workers + Durable Objects with a Vite-first DX.

## Usage
```ts
import { formatAdvisories, runCodegen } from "@lunora/codegen";
const result = runCodegen({ projectRoot: process.cwd() });
console.log(`wrote _generated/ -> ${result.outputDirectory}`);
// Static schema advisories (e.g. unindexed foreign keys) found this run.
// runCodegen does not print them; surface them through your own channel.
if (result.advisories.length > 0) {
console.warn(formatAdvisories(result.advisories));
}
```
`runCodegen` takes a single `CodegenOptions` object. The common fields:
- `projectRoot` (required) — directory containing the `lunora/` folder.
- `dryRun` — run discovery + emit (so parse errors still surface) without writing files. `outputDirectory` is still the path that would have been written.
- `lint` — run the static schema advisor (default `true`); when `false`, `result.advisories` is empty.
- `apiSpec` — `"openapi"` (default), `"openrpc"`, `"both"`, or `"none"`; controls which machine-readable API spec files get written.
- `lunoraDirectory` — override the `lunora` subdirectory name.
The emitted `_generated/*` modules are consumed under NodeNext, so their imports carry `.js` extensions — for example `import { api } from "./_generated/api.js"`. This is the one place in the codebase where hand-written `.js` extensions are correct.
